Overview

The ignition coil market plays a critical role in the internal combustion engine (ICE) segment of the automotive industry. Ignition coils are essential components that convert low-voltage battery power into the high-voltage charge needed to ignite the air-fuel mixture in the engine’s cylinders. These coils ensure efficient combustion, optimal engine performance, and reduced emissions.

Despite the rising popularity of electric vehicles (EVs), the global demand for ICE and hybrid vehicles, especially in emerging economies, continues to fuel the growth of the ignition coil market. Innovations in ignition coil design—like compact, high-performance coils for turbocharged engines—are further driving market expansion.

Key Players

1. Denso Corporation (Japan)

A global leader in automotive components, offering high-performance, compact ignition coils with a focus on durability and emissions control.

2. Bosch Limited (Germany)

Known for advanced ignition technologies, Bosch supplies both OEM and aftermarket segments across regions.

3. Delphi Technologies (UK)

Now part of BorgWarner, Delphi provides reliable, high-output ignition systems used widely in turbocharged engines.

4. NGK Spark Plug Co., Ltd. (Japan)

Offers a diverse range of ignition coils known for long service life and strong ignition performance.

5. Hitachi Astemo (Japan)

Delivers integrated ignition solutions with a focus on fuel economy and reduced emissions for hybrid and ICE vehicles.

6. Standard Motor Products (USA)

A prominent supplier of ignition coils to the North American aftermarket, known for its wide range and cost-effective offerings.


Regional Analysis

Asia-Pacific

Holds the largest market share due to the high volume of vehicle production in China, India, Japan, and South Korea. Growth in two-wheeler and compact car segments, coupled with robust aftermarket demand, supports continued expansion.

Europe

Focuses on advanced and high-performance ignition technologies to meet Euro emission standards. Growth is also driven by hybrid vehicle adoption in Germany, France, and the UK.

North America

Driven by demand for high-efficiency engines and performance vehicles. The U.S. aftermarket segment is particularly strong, with increasing replacement rates due to vehicle aging.

Latin America & Middle East

Moderate but growing market due to rising vehicle penetration, especially in Brazil, Mexico, and GCC countries. The market is supported by import-based aftermarket demand.


Latest Developments (2025)

  • Compact Coil Designs: Innovations aimed at improving engine bay space utilization, especially for hybrid powertrains.
  • High Energy Ignition Systems: Designed to support direct-injection turbocharged engines.
  • Smart Ignition Coils: Integration with engine control units (ECUs) for real-time diagnostics and performance tuning.
  • Aftermarket Expansion: Increasing e-commerce distribution of ignition coils globally.
  • Stricter Emission Norms: Encouraging automakers to use more efficient and durable ignition systems.
